Explore the Architectural Marvels
One of Bradford's most striking features is its Victorian architecture. Make sure to visit the historic City Hall, an iconic building with a stunning clock tower that dominates the cityscape. For a touch of culture, the Alhambra Theatre offers a beautiful example of Edwardian architecture and hosts a variety of performances year-round.
Don't miss the magnificent Cartwright Hall, set within the scenic grounds of Lister Park. This art gallery houses an impressive collection of contemporary and classical pieces, making it a must-see for art enthusiasts.

Savor Bradford's Culinary Delights
Bradford is famously known for its curry, having been crowned the "Curry Capital of Britain" multiple times. For an authentic culinary experience, visit the renowned restaurants along Leeds Road. Whether you prefer mild or spicy flavors, you'll find a dish to suit your palate.
For those with a sweet tooth, Bradford's local bakeries offer a delightful array of traditional pastries and cakes. Be sure to try the Yorkshire Parkin, a ginger cake that's a regional favorite.

Immerse Yourself in History
The National Science and Media Museum is a treasure trove of exhibits that explore the history of photography, film, and television. It's an engaging stop for visitors of all ages. Additionally, the Bradford Industrial Museum provides insight into the city's industrial past, with fascinating displays of vintage machinery and textiles.
If you're interested in learning more about the region's history, a visit to Bolling Hall is highly recommended. This stately home offers a glimpse into the lives of Bradford's past inhabitants, with rooms filled with period furnishings and intriguing stories.

Relax in Bradford's Green Spaces
After a day of exploring, take some time to unwind in one of Bradford's beautiful parks. Lister Park, with its boating lake and lush gardens, is perfect for a leisurely stroll. Alternatively, Peel Park offers expansive green lawns and picturesque views, ideal for a relaxing afternoon picnic.
For nature enthusiasts, the nearby Ilkley Moor provides a serene escape with its rugged landscape and breathtaking vistas. It's a great spot for hiking and appreciating the beauty of the Yorkshire countryside.
